Mobile Wallets Compared to Traditional Payment Gateways
In the ever-evolving world of payments, new technologies are constantly emerging. Two prominent players in this arena are mobile wallets, which offer a convenient and secure method for transactions, and classic e-commerce payment solutions, the long-standing workhorses of online commerce. While both facilitate seamless money transfers, they differ significantly in terms of their capabilities and strengths.
- Mobile wallets offer a more streamlined payment process, often involving simply a swipe of the phone.
- Established online payment platforms provide a more robust platform with a wider range of linkages and protective measures.
Choosing the optimal alternative depends on particular circumstances, such as the size of the business, the kinds of transactions processed, and the required degree of security.
